Some are consumed with avarice all the day, but the just give unsparingly. Proverbs 21:26

Children, let no one deceive you. The person who acts in righteousness is righteous, just as He is righteous. Whoever sins belongs to the devil, because the devil has sinned from the beginning. Indeed, the Son of God was revealed to destroy the works of the devil. 1 John 3:7-8

Blessed are they who hunger and thirst for righteousness, for they will be satisfied. Matthew 5:6

1 John 3:1-8, Proverbs 21:24-27 & Matthew 5:1-12A

The search for righteousness begins with opening your Bible in practice allowing the Holy Spirit to lead your every thought as you learn to give what God is asking for the glory of Truth. The consumption of life for the exaltation of self brings upon the soul salivation from sin employing works of the devil sparingly giving what you selfishly obtained. Once you experience the feeling of God’s grace and somewhat understand how to maintain this as the Will of God for your life, prayer becomes the natural state of speaking evoking God and His Son’s freedom from sin unafraid to share righteousness as the only real thing that takes away the need of living for anything else.

We find the material world is not necessities but obvious graces coming from our God-given journey of His Will. We can act as if giving isn’t the reason for faith, hope and love until the very soul withers away to dust void of anything obtained materially suffocated in the oven of Eternity’s wrath. Beware we are told by John to “let no one deceive you” finding Only in Christ what the world over in avarice behavior will try and take away and deceive you by. We must unsparingly give to the works of practice, prayer and proclamation employing the charitable acts of Truth we give back from the graces we hunger by from the only love our universe was created by. Not the Devil but God. Amen.
